Websage.graphs.spanning_tree.edge_disjoint_spanning_trees(G, k, by_weight=False, weight_function=None, check_weight=True) #. Return k edge-disjoint spanning trees of minimum cost. This method implements the Roskind-Tarjan algorithm for finding k minimum-cost edge-disjoint spanning trees in simple undirected graphs [RT1985].

WebCommon digraphs #. Common digraphs. #. All digraphs in Sage can be built through the digraphs object. In order to build a circuit on 15 elements, one can do: sage: g = digraphs.Circuit(15) To get a circulant graph on 10 vertices in which a vertex i has i + 2 and i + 3 as outneighbors: sage: p = digraphs.Circulant(10, [2,3]) More interestingly ... Return a rose window graph with 2 n nodes. The rose window graphs is a family of tetravalant graphs introduced in [Wilson2008]. The parameters n, a and r are integers such that n > 2, 1 ≤ a, r < n, and r ≠ n / 2.
